Warning
Regulations require that this appliance be earthed:
The manufacture declines all liability for injury to persons or animals and for damage to property resulting
from failure to observe the above procedures and reminders.
If the socket and plug are not of the same type either the socket or the plug must be replaced by a qualified
electrician.
Under no circumstances use extension leads or adaptors.
1. The appliance should be connected by an authorised electrician or by the company that sold the
appliance. Incorrect installation may damage the appliance.
2. Place the appliance on a flat floor that can bear the weight of the appliance.
3. The electrical installation should be earthed.
4. Do not use extension cables. Connect the appliance directly to a fixed installation. If the appliance is
connected to a long extension cable there is a risk that the cable will become hot.
5. The appliance should be placed in a dry location. Do not allow water to come into contact with the
cabinet. Water entering electrical parts may cause short-circuiting.
6. In the event of functional or electrical irregularities, please contact an authorised service engineer.
Before Commissioning
Clean the freezer both inside and out using a damp, wrung out cloth. Dry with a dry cloth.
The smell from the plastic parts in the freezer will disappear once the freezer has been cooled down.
Starting procedure
Put the plug in the socket.
The thermostat pre-set by the producer. The appliance should run for at least 6 hours before the thermostat
is changed to allow for stabilisation of the cooling system.
Starting up the freezer
Start the freezer. Set the digital thermometer at the temperature required. It will now take about
6-10 hours before the set temperature is reached.
The freezer should be cooled down empty.
When filling the unit with racks/boxes, make sure to pre-cool them in order not to effect the inside
temperature of the unit.
Disconnecting the appliance
Electrical disconnecting must be possible either by unplugging the appliance or by means of a double pole
switch located up-line from the socket.
